Jammu artists to participate in art exhibition at Chamba

Excelsior Correspondent
JAMMU, Sept 26: Three Jammu based artists will participate in an All India Art Exhibition and Nature Sketching & Drawing Workshop at Chamba (Himachal Pradesh).
The event would commence at Bhuri Singh Museum, Chamba on September 27, 2016 and conclude on September 30, 2016. The event is being organized by Himachal Art Heritage, Sunder Nagar (HP), ArtFort India, Chandigarh and VCC, Jammu.
The artists whose works would be put on display in this exhibition are Prabhinder Lall, Chandigarh, Naveen Dhiman, Himachal Pradesh, Sankari Mittra, West Bengal, Jang S Verman, Anuradha Devi and Shivali Jamwal (Jammu & Kashmir).
The mixed works of the senior and young artists will present the prevailing scenario in the field of art in the country. First ever such event in Chamba would reflect to the local people and tourists the mediums, techniques and styles used by some of the Indian artists. Side by side these artists will work on sketching and making drawings on the picturesque view of Chamba and surrounding areas of Himachal Pradesh.
It may be reminded that artists who are taking part in this event are professionally trained ones. They have displayed their art at international and national level platforms many times.
